    I am running Windows XP Professional / Athlon 64 X2 Dual Core / ASUS A8N32 SLI-Deluxe. Immediately after installing SP3, I got the BSOD so quickly I couldn't read any info, and then automatically restarted, and continued this cycle. I couldn't get it to boot in safe mode, or any other mode. I removed all Floppy/IDE devices except my primary hard drive, and it booted fine. I started adding devices, and every time I add a different HD, either as a primary slave or a secondary master or slave, the computer won't get any farther than the Windows boot screen before the BSOD. The bios recognizes the drives, I have tried all possible jumper configs (MA/SL, CS/SL, CS/CS, MA/CS) and installing Win XP Pro SP3 on different HDs with the same results, (so I could rule out that it was a Seagate or WD problem). I have tried rolling back the drivers on my primary IDE channel, secondary IDE channel, and Standard Dual Channel PCI/IDE controller as well, to no avail.
    Of a lesser; but maybe related; concern, I have also had problems with my CDRW/DVDRW master/slave configuration that I prefer to have on my secondary IDE channel, but both these drives have given me problems b4 in SP2, and I have been unable to determine if this is a continuation of earlier issues, or related to the probs I am having with running a slave drive on my primary controller.
    Any Ideas?
